{"id":7719,"date":"2006-05-18T16:17:50","date_gmt":"2006-05-18T21:17:50","guid":{"rendered":"http:\/\/blogs.covchurch.org\/newswire\/?p=7719"},"modified":"2011-07-06T08:32:00","modified_gmt":"2011-07-06T13:32:00","slug":"4910","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/blogs.covchurch.org\/newswire\/2006\/05\/18\/4910\/","title":{"rendered":"NCP President \u2013 Job Description"},"content":{"rendered":"<p>CHICAGO, IL (May 18, 2006)  &#8211; Following is a brief history and the job  description for the position of president of National Covenant Properties.<!--more--><\/p>\n<p><strong>Brief history<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The mission of National Covenant Properties is to be <em>THE<\/em> loan  source for Evangelical Covenant churches.<\/p>\n<p>National Covenant Properties (NCP) was established in 1970 by the  Evangelical Covenant Church (ECC) as an Illinois not-for-profit  corporation for the purpose of making loans to member churches and other  affiliated entitles of the denomination. NCP is registered as a  501(c)(3) organization.<\/p>\n<p>Assets currently exceed $245 million. The principal source of funds to  make loans is the sale of debt securities by NCP to members of,  contributors to, participants in, and affiliates of the denomination and  its member churches. The debt securities offered are Five-Year Fixed  Rate Renewable Certificates, Variable Rate Certificates, Individual  Retirement Account (IRA) Certificates, and Health Savings Account (HSA)  Certificates. Certificates are sold nationwide under guidelines that  apply to the various jurisdictions in which they are offered or sold by NCP.<\/p>\n<p>National Covenant Properties operates under the loan and investment  policies established by its board of directors. The board consists of  not less than eight and not more than 13 directors, of which the  president of NCP is an ex officio director, as is the president of the  ECC. The board of directors meets every other month and currently  approves every loan and line of credit in excess of $50,000 made by NCP.  The corporate members of NCP are those persons who currently serve as  elected members of the Executive Board of the ECC.<\/p>\n<p>NCP functions in close partnership with the Department of Church Growth  and Evangelism. The director of technical services of that department  currently serves as the secretary on the National Covenant Properties  Board of Directors. Consultations and coordination between the president  of NCP and this ministry arm of the denomination are essential to the  overall support provided to local churches and regional conferences,  particularly for new Covenant churches.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Responsibilities<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The president of NCP serves on a full-time basis, overseeing the work of  a small staff and bearing overall responsibility for the successful  management of this multi-million-dollar corporation. This responsibility  includes financial, personnel, and systems management, as well as  extensive and effective relationships with borrowers, investors, and  board members. The president, a leader within the denomination, is  charged with achieving the strategic goals established by the board of  directors. The following outlines key aspects of the various functions  of the president: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><em>Loans<\/em> &#8211; The president personally works with leaders in  churches, regional conferences and the denomination to offer guidance  and to inform churches regarding NCP policies. The president assists  borrowers in achieving their objectives while at the same time ensuring  the financial integrity and viability of NCP, as well as fulfilling a  fiduciary responsibility to investors. The goal is to establish and  maintain a high level of &#8220;client&#8221; satisfaction, with effective  communications and practical assistance. The president personally  reviews all loan applications and tailors the structure of each loan to  the specific circumstances of the individual church, consulting with  others throughout the denomination as appropriate. The president  recommends the most appropriate alternative among various courses of  action open to NCP and offers supporting rationale. Guidance in contract  and escrow matters, particularly when churches lack specific expertise,  is provided as part of the ministry of NCP. Establishing and maintaining  relationships with title companies, banking institutions and legal  counsel are part of the daily interactions of the president. Of  particular importance is the maintenance of effective working relations  between NCP and the Department of Church Growth and Evangelism.<\/li>\n<li><em>Investments<\/em> &#8211; In the area of investments and the generation  of funds to continue this vital support ministry, the president is  responsible for communicating opportunities and reinforcing the message  of NCP&#8217;s mission with investors through direct mailings, responding to  telephone inquires, and making presentations that outline the nature and  purpose of NCP at annual meetings or other events. Leading and enhancing  a &#8220;customer oriented staff&#8221; that cordially and professionally interacts  with investors is a key responsibility of the president, in addition to  providing timely and correct reports, maintaining accurate and  accessible records, helping with certificate redemption or renewal,  communicating interest rate changes, and assisting holders of IRA and  HSA accounts on reporting consequences of various transactions. In  addition, the president is responsible for selecting the type of and  timing for prudent investment of the assets of NCP, following policy  guidelines, so that funds are available to meet loan demand while  providing the best available rate of return.<\/li>\n<li><em>Planning and Reporting<\/em> &#8211; The president develops the rationale  for recommendations for the rates that are set by the board of directors  for both loans and certificate offerings, recommends new or revised  policies, develops budget recommendations and annual projections,  ensures accurate, comprehensive and timely reporting to the board of  directors and to the Internal Revenue Service and other entities, and  oversees the development and use of supporting systems (such as document  storage, retrieval and application systems). Throughout the spectrum of  activity, the president recommends, implements and monitors policies and  procedures to ensure accuracy, security, and legal\/regulatory compliance.<\/li>\n<li><em>Supervision<\/em> &#8211; The president is responsible for all aspects of  the organization, including the supervision and employment of all other  members of the NCP staff. The president achieves goals and objectives by  prioritizing and allocating staff resources as needed, and actively  developing and counseling staff in their professional and personal  career development<\/li>\n<li><em>Other Leadership Roles<\/em> &#8211; The president serves as a member of  the Council of Administrators of the ECC and as an advisor to the  officers and Executive Board of the ECC. As a member of the council and  advisor to the executive board, the president regularly participates in  matters related to church development and financial management and is  available to accept special assignments that occasionally come from the  Council of Administrators. The president is also an ex officio director  of Covenant Development Corporation, the real estate development arm of  the denomination.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><strong> Qualifications<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The president of NCP is someone who: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Is a growing Christian-a person who loves God, is committed to  following Jesus Christ and is responsive to the Holy Spirit.
